The prevalence of Kidney stones, medically known as Renal stones or Nephrolithiasis, has increased world over.   You too must have encountered one or more persons having stones in kidney. These patients are widely advised in India, about which food they should eat and which food to avoid; Advised about gulping down water to flush out the stones. No doubt, these suggestions prove to be very useful in some cases. But, one should also be aware that some kidney stones can pose great difficulty and discomfort, while passing out through ureters. Like, stones larger than 5 mm in size, staghorn stones, etc.

We attempt to answer few of the most frequently asked questions by the patients about kidney stones:

What age group is commonly involved?

It occurs more commonly in the younger age groups (Males).

What all factors influence stone formation?

• Climate • Occupation • Diet • Water intake

Which is the most common type of stone?

Commonest stone is calcium oxalate, then uric acid and then infection stones.

Calcium Oxalate stones: High oxalate is found in potato chips, peanuts, chocolates, beets and spinach.

Uric Acid stones are associated with gout. More acidic the urine, greater are the chances of these stones being formed.

Infection stones may arise because of recurrent Urinary Tract Infections.

What are the most common presenting complaints?

• Pain in abdomen
• Fever
• Blood in urine
• Repeated block in urine stream
• Difficulty in passing urine
• Sense of incomplete emptying
• Nausea
• Vomiting

However, large stones can be silent.

What all treatment options are available?
1) Small stones can pass out on their own.
2) Bigger stones – require surgery
• ESWL – Limited indication today  REASON ???

• PCNL- small cut is made on back and the stone is broken before removing

• URS- scope is introduced from the urinary passage in ureter and the stone is removed

BPH (Benign Prosthetic Hyperplasia or Hypertrophy) pertains to the inflammation of the prostrate gland, found in males. It is the most common fitness problem in ageing men, impacting both the health as well as health-care costs. BPH is not harmful but can be very discomforting. If diagnosed and treated early, it can ease a lot of inconvenience faced by the patients.

An enlarged prostate puts pressure on the urethra that causes most of the symptoms. Urethra is a tube that carries urine from bladder to outside the body.

What are the early Signs and Symptoms?
Thin stream of urine
Sense of incomplete evacuation
Dribbling of urine
Intermittent seam
Hesitancy
Pain and burning during urination
Bleeding
Urine frequency increased especially at night
Urgency
Urine leak

70% of times, the problems can be cured medically. Only in 30% cases surgery is required. There are 3 types of surgery:

– Open: In this a cut is made and the prostate is removed.

– Endoscopy- TURP- In this a scope is put inside from the urinary opening and the prostate is excised. No external cut is made.
